Special Events / Policy Changes
- Unlike the previous year, where rebel children were picked, any child between the ages of 12 and 18 had their names put into the Reaping. Citizens 'complacent' to the war had one slip, while rebel children had three.
Arena
- The same dilapidated amphitheater used for the first games.
- Games staff left bottles of water around the arena, underneath seats and the pile of weapons. Luna Henson was the only tribute who managed to find any.
- There were wooden shields hidden in the entrance tunnels.

The Games
- The first-ever suicide occurred when Cassie Lundstrom, cornered by Berta O'Malley, slit her own wrists to avoid a painful, bludgeoned death.
- Polish Samuels, Yorgos Sarno, Athena Pinto, Thera Pavesi, and Milton Dumas joined as an alliance and tried convincing everyone to put down their weapons.

Selini Grayson - District 2 Female
Age: 17
Appearance: Gray eyes / Medium, wavy, brown hair / Olive skin / Short and stocky
Placed 2nd / Died in Hour 4 / Stabbed through the heart with a sword by Divine St. Pierre (D1F)
- Selini was born and raised in a mining village near the Riverstone quarry. Her mother died during childbirth and her father was in prison for murder of a Peacekeeper, so she was raised since she was eleven by her grandmother.
- In her early teen years, she spent her time street-fighting with the local kids. It was never malicious; they were all friends, but they never held back. Several of her fingers never healed properly.
- When the buzzer sounded to signify the start of the games, she ran in for the hammer, which Saddle Silva from District 10 also ran for. They wrestled on the concrete for it until she freed it from him and caved his head in.
- She killed four: Nitzan, Conrado, Larus, and Saddle.
- In the final fight between her and Divine, she spat at her opponent and called her a lapdog. She told Divine that defile her body so that her own parents won't recognise her when her body is shipped back to One.
Conrado Bennett - District 4 Male
Age: 14
Appearance: Green eyes / Medium, wavy, brown hair / Brown skin / Average height and well-fed
Placed 4th / Died in Hour 4 / Speared through the back by Selini Grayson (D2F)
- Conrado's family were net-makers. It was a family business that was started by his great-grandmother and remained strong through the generations. The Bennetts were neutral during the war, except for his older sister. She shot down six Peacekeepers during riots around the base.
- He begged the Peacekeepers to let him run off. He offered to bang them around a bit to make it look like they put up a fight. Their response was backhanding him and throwing him into the cattle car.
- His district partner, Berta O'Malley, attempted to soothe him as he sobbed, but he ignored her completely.
- During the initial dash for weapons, he received a deep and nasty gash across the back of his thigh from Boza Brownlow, who attacked him with a scythe. Conrado managed to escape without killing Boza.
- He crept around the stands, avoiding the other tributes until there were only a handful of them left.
Larus Lynwood - District 7 Male
Age: 17
Appearance: Brown eyes / Long, wavy, black hair / Brown skin / Tall and wiry
Placed 3rd / Died in Hour 4 / Speared through the heart by Selini Grayson (D2F)
- Born and raised in a western village. He was handling axes almost since the moment he could walk. Dr. Gaul gleefully mentioned his build when she watched the reaping and suggested that maybe Seven will get another victor in Larus.
- His girlfriend was eight weeks pregnant when he was reaped. The stress of not knowing his fate caused her to miscarry the baby.
- He made the first kill of the games when he threw his axe into Sem Nystrom's head from ten yards away.
- Selini Grayson punched him in the face so hard that he lost six teeth. It was the pain shooting through his head that gave her the advantage over him.
- He allied with Yancy Murtaz for roughly an hour, because she reminded him of his girlfriend. When he saw Conrado Bennett coming for them, he slipped away without telling her.
- He burst into tears when he realised he was about to die, begging Selini to spare him.
Luna Henson - District 10 Female
Age: 18
Appearance: Brown eyes / Medium, curly, black hair / Brown skin / Short and stocky
Placed 11th / Died in Hour 2 / Speared through the heart by Conrado Bennett (D4M)
- The Hensons raised the horses that rebel soldiers in District 10 rode on to overwhelm Peacekeeper forces. They lived in northern District 10, and managed to smuggle more into Two, Five, and Nine due to their proximity.
- Yancy Murtaz from District 9 told Luna that she thought those horses were beautiful and that they were one of the only good things she saw during the war.
- She was bitten by a spider on the train to the Capitol, and by the time the tributes were shoved into the arena, she was extremely sick. The only reason she lasted so long is because of how well she hid.
- She found a couple of plastic bottles of water beneath the seats in the stands. She guzzled the first down too quickly, and vomited it back up.
- Somehow she fought off Savio Hermans, who fought Luna for the second bottle. Luna didn't kill him, but the commotion brought them to Conrado's attention, who killed them.
Simon Reeve - District 13 Male
Age: 17
Appearance: Gray eyes / Short, curly, black hair / Dark skin / Tall and underweight
Placed 18th / Died in Hour 1 / Throat slashed with a sword by Divine St. Pierre (D1F)
- Grew up in a north-eastern graphic mining village, and though he wasn't a miner, he knew how to handle weapons from training in school.
- He raised chickens in a little coop just outside his home. His younger sister continued raising them after his death.
- He broke the arm of the Peacekeeper trying to force him into the cattle car. He was punched repeatedly and knocked out by the other soldiers. When he came to, he was in immense pain. Divine said a snarky comment, and he insulted her in several ways.
- When she made a beeline for him in the arena, he shrieked crazily at her and flapped his arms around, trying to deter her. It didn't work whatsoever.
- Dr. Gaul was so amused by his bizarre strategy that she listed as one of her favourite moments of the games, just from how random and unexpected it was.
Victor
Divine St. Pierre - District 1 Female
Age: 18
Appearance: Green eyes / Medium, straight, blonde hair / Light skin / Tall and well-fed
- Born and raised in a northern town, just south of the District 7 border. The St. Pierres were one of the Great Houses of District 1 and the founding family of the Entertainers' Guild. Her family were torn in half by the rebellion, and she lost many cousins, aunts, and uncles to the loyalists. Though her parents were loyal, she and her older sister harbored rebel sympathies. Her name wasn't put in the Reaping pool for the first games, but she did have a slip in the second Reaping. It was enough to condemn her.
- Rebels stormed the Great Houses of District 1 during the war. Divine had to protect herself as they stalked through the St. Pierre vineyards. In self-defense, she killed three rebels as her family manor burned to the ground in the distance.
- Divine's father, Hans, demanded to the mayor that she draw another girl's name, as their family had been passionate loyalists and spoke in favor of the Capitol during the war. The mayor refused and told him that it was Capitol's orders. Divine would have to be sent to the arena. He was allowed to speak with his daughter beforehand, though what they spoke about is unknown.
- Well-fed, athletic, graceful with a sword, and experience killing. She was a shoo-in for the victor and Dr. Gaul anticipated her to at least be the final female tribute left alive.
- Divine played aggressively but defensively. She attacked no one until the final six, and only finished fights that came to her. She hid away in the entrance tunnels a few hours into the games and found the pile of wooden shields. She and Larus Lynwood were the only two who found them, and in the final battle, Selini Grayson took Larus' shield from his corpse. Their fight lasted forty-five minutes, much to the glee of Dr. Gaul.
- Divine killed five: Simon (13), Milton (11), Berta (4), Roselle (11), and Selini (2).
- She showed remorse for killing but no regret, stating in the 20th-anniversary interview that she did what the games called for her to do.
- After the second games, she returned to District 1 and became heavily involved in her family's export. She spoke in support of the Capitol, however behind closed doors she still supported rebel ideals. She disliked the dictatorship of the Capitol.
- She began training children to survive the games around the time of the fifteenth games, a precursor to the 'Inner-District Alliance', also known as 'Careers' in outer districts.
- She was given a house in the Victors' Village retroactively, but she barely stayed there. She did host dinners there once a month with other District 1 victors.
- She avoided celebrity status like most from the first decade, but she was deeply respected by the Capitol and other victors.
- She would marry Peony Anderson, a man from the Gardeners' Guild, when she was twenty-six. He took her surname to continue the St. Pierre legacy. They had three children between the seventeenth and twenty-first games; Wonder, Beauty, and Glisser.
- When riots broke out eight months before the twenty-fifth games, rebels stormed the St. Pierre manor once again. Peony and Divine died protecting their children from the rebels, and she was mourned deeply by Panem.
- Though her children's names were put in the Reaping like everyone else, the mayor specifically rigged it so that they weren't chosen by marking their slips with a small mark of red pen on the corner of the paper.
- She didn't mentor. However, she did serve as a right-hand woman to the victors from One who mentored, ran errands, and sat meetings for them.
